A website migration is one of the few events that can remove years of accumulated search visibility in a single afternoon. It is also one of the few where the risk is entirely known in advance, which makes the frequency of failure difficult to justify.

The pattern is consistent. A new site is commissioned for good reasons — the old one is dated, hard to maintain, poor on mobile. The agency building it is competent at design and development. Nobody in the project is responsible for the question of whether the new site will be found, because it did not occur to anyone that a better website could perform worse.

Three months after launch, traffic is down forty per cent, and the conversation becomes an argument about whose responsibility it was.

How a migration is protected

The work divides across three phases, and the first is where nearly all of the value sits. By launch day, the outcome is largely already determined.

  1. Before: establish what must be preserved

    A complete inventory of every address that currently earns visibility, receives links or converts. Built from analytics, Search Console, server logs and a full crawl rather than from the sitemap alone, because the sitemap is always incomplete.

  2. Before: review the proposed structure

    Whether the new architecture preserves what matters, where content is being consolidated or dropped, and whether the new templates will present content in a form search engines can process. This is where changes are still cheap.

  3. Before: build and verify the mapping

    Every old address mapped to its closest equivalent, with any address that has no equivalent flagged as a decision rather than a redirect to the home page. Verified on staging before anyone commits to a launch date.

  4. During: pre-launch verification

    Confirming on staging that indexing directives are correct, structured data survived, canonical declarations point where intended, and the staging environment's blocking directives will not follow the site into production.

  5. During: launch-day checks

    Immediate verification that redirects are live and returning permanent status codes, that the production site is indexable, and that nothing is returning errors at scale. The first two hours matter disproportionately.

  6. After: monitoring and correction

    Tracking indexation, errors and visibility daily for the first fortnight and weekly thereafter. Migration problems announce themselves early to anyone watching for them and are considerably cheaper to fix in week one than in month three.

By the time a migration launches, whether it will succeed has already been decided. Launch day is when you find out, not when you influence it.

What actually goes wrong

Migration failures are remarkably consistent. In nearly every case the cause is one of a small number of mistakes, all of which are preventable and most of which are invisible until traffic falls.

The most damaging is also the most common: an incomplete redirect map. It happens because the map is built from the pages the organisation remembers, and websites accumulate pages nobody remembers — old campaign landing pages, articles from a previous marketing manager, product pages for discontinued lines that still hold links.

  • Incomplete redirect mapping. Addresses that earned value return errors instead of resolving.
  • Staging directives shipped to production. The blocking rule that protected staging follows the site live.
  • Content quietly reduced. A cleaner design turns out to mean substantially less text.
  • Content moved behind JavaScript. What was in the response now arrives after execution.
  • Internal linking flattened. A simplified navigation removes the signals that distinguished important pages.
  • Structured data lost. Markup that existed on the old templates was never carried across.
  • Redirect chains. The new map layered on top of an old one, so requests resolve in four hops.

Migrations this applies to

Not all of these are equally risky. Domain changes and platform changes carry the most exposure; a template refresh carries the least, but not none.

Platform change

Moving between content management systems or ecommerce platforms. High risk, because URL structures, templates and rendering behaviour all change simultaneously.

Domain change

Rebrand, acquisition or consolidation. The highest-risk category, because every signal the previous domain accumulated must be transferred deliberately.

Site consolidation

Merging several sites into one. Complex because content must be combined without creating pages that compete with each other for the same intent.

Redesign on the same platform

Lower risk, and not zero. Template changes alter content volume, heading structure and internal linking, all of which affect how pages are assessed.

Internationalisation

Adding language or regional variants. Risky in a distinctive way: the errors tend to produce duplication and misdirected visitors rather than lost pages.

Protocol or subdomain change

Moving to HTTPS, or between www and non-www. Mechanically simple, frequently done incompletely, and easy to verify properly.

Frequently asked questions

When should we involve you?
Before the new site's structure is decided, which is usually earlier than people expect. By the time a build is in progress, the URL structure and content architecture are fixed, and those are precisely the decisions that determine whether visibility survives. Involvement at the wireframe stage costs a fraction of involvement at launch and prevents considerably more.
We are only changing the design, not the URLs. Is this still relevant?
Often yes, because design changes rarely stay design changes. Template changes affect heading structure, content volume, internal linking and how much of the page exists before JavaScript runs. Any of those can move visibility. It is a smaller engagement than a full migration, but it is not nothing.
How much traffic is normally lost in a migration?
A well-executed migration should see a modest dip for a few weeks as pages are recrawled and reassessed, then a return to the previous level. Larger and longer losses indicate something went wrong rather than being an inevitable cost. We do not accept the premise that losing a quarter of your traffic is a normal price for a new website.
What is the single most common cause of migration failure?
Incomplete redirect mapping, by a wide margin. Usually because the mapping was built from the sitemap rather than from every address that actually earned visibility or received links, which are different sets. Pages nobody remembered are frequently the ones carrying the most accumulated value.
Can you help after a migration has already gone wrong?
Yes, and quickly is better than thoroughly at that stage. The first priority is establishing which previous addresses are returning errors and redirecting them, because every day that persists is more of your previous positions being reallocated. The forensic work can follow once the bleeding has stopped.
